Gazette Information: VICTORIA CROSS,: https://www.thegazette.co.uk/London/issue/35207/supplement/3807. Corporal John Hurst Edmondson, 2/17th Battalion, Australian Military Forces. During the night of 13th/14th April 1941 at Tobruk, Libya, Corporal Edmondson was severely wounded while serving with a party which was counter-attacking the enemy who had broken through the barbed wire defences. He continued to advance, however, under heavy fire and went to the assistance of his officer who was in difficulties – he had his bayonet through one of the enemy, who in turn was clasping the officer round his legs, and another of the enemy was attacking from behind. Corporal Edmondson, in spite of his wounds, immediately came to the rescue and killed both of the enemy. He died shortly afterwards.
